Dataset associated with the following publication:
Billino,J., Hennig, J., & Gegenfurtner K.R. (2016). Association between COMT genotype and the control of memory guided saccades: Individual differences in healthy adults reveal a detrimental role of dopamine. Vision Research. doi: 10.1016/j.visres.2016.10.001
--------------------------------------------------------------
The folder contains 4 data files and 1 description file providing column labels.
The data file 'maindata.txt' contains the complete dataset including all analyzed parameters.
The data file 'accuracybydelay.txt' contains accuracy data across delay conditions, providing the dataset for Figure 3A.
The data file 'accuracybyamplitude.txt' contains accuracy data across target amplitude conditions, providing the dataset for Figure 3B.
The data file 'singlesublanding.txt' contains landing positions of primary memory guided saccades from three subjects of different genotype groups, providing the dataset for Figure 3C.
